SourceMedical is currently seeking a Business Analyst – Therapy Product, for its corporate headquarters location in Birmingham, AL.
Summary of Position:
As a Business Analyst, you will be a key member of the SourceMedical Product Management Team with the overall responsibility for deliverables and projects related to the development, release and positioning of next generation SourceMedical software solutions. As an individual contributor in this role, you will focus on identifying, researching, analyzing, validating and documenting business and functional requirements for specific market sector(s).
To be successful in this role, you will need excellent project management and written/verbal communication skills with the ability to work with a wide range of internal and external stakeholders as a high-performing team member.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
1. Conducts analysis and research for product line and industry resulting in accurate business and functional requirements. Translates analysis and research data into valid use cases, business requirements, scope documentation and definitions, functional specifications and competitive intelligence documentation for use in the product development cycle.
2. Utilizes core project management skills to effectively manage projects across time span, ensuring project deliverables are timely and accurate. Follows up on all project requests with task owners to ensure closure and satisfaction with action taken or product delivered. Acts autonomously to complete work by plan deadline, seeks guidance as appropriate.
3. Uses effective communication strategies to effectively conduct needs analysis and communicate research results in clear and concise fashion. Adjusts communication strategy across written, verbal and presentation modes to match target audience (internal and external) and technical competency.
4. Effectively complies with all administrative tasks required as a Business Analyst (Examples include but are not limited to the following: active participation in meetings, creation and generation of reports, responding to internal and external correspondence and other related administrative tasks, etc.)
5. Transfer knowledge to other areas of the company including Sales, Client Services and Product Development on the features, functionality and future direction of the products.
6. Other duties and responsibilities as assigned by supervisor.
Education/Qualifications:
--BA/BS degree in Business, Healthcare, Information Technology or related area of study
--2-5 years of demonstrated work experience evaluating, defining and implementing deliverables for cross-functional, large-scale projects in a product management capacity
--Demonstrated ability in translating business and functional requirements into requirement documentation, use cases and functional specifications using industry-standard product development documentation processes.
--Demonstrated ability to successfully evaluate requirements with varying levels of complexity and communicate those requirements to technical and non-technical audiences
--Experience in contributing to the design of GUI and usability concepts that result in an intuitive user experience.
--Effective interpersonal skills (presentation, written and oral) and the ability to communicate effectively with a variety of staff levels
--Experience in software development, outpatient healthcare and healthcare billing practices preferred
Travel Requirements:
--Limited to 10% travel is required.
